إثبات المعرفة الصفرية في بلوكتشين
<h2>إثبات المعرفة الصفرية في بلوكتشين</h2>
<p>مرحباً يا قارئ، هل تساءلت يومًا عن كيفية إثبات امتلاكك لمعلومة ما دون الكشف عن المعلومة نفسها؟ هذا هو جوهر إثبات المعرفة الصفرية، وهي تقنية ثورية تغير قواعد اللعبة في عالم البلوكتشين. <strong>تخيل عالمًا يمكنك فيه التحقق من هويتك دون الكشف عن بياناتك الشخصية، أو إثبات ملكيتك لأصل رقمي دون الكشف عن تفاصيله</strong>. لقد قمت بتحليل إثبات المعرفة الصفرية في بلوكتشين بشكل معمق، وسأشارككم خبرتي في هذا المقال.</p>
<p>سنتعمق في مفهوم إثبات المعرفة الصفرية في بلوكتشين، ونستكشف تطبيقاتها الواعدة في عالم العملات الرقمية والبلوكتشين. سنلقي نظرة على الفوائد والتحديات، بالإضافة إلى مستقبل هذه التقنية المبتكرة.</p>
<center><img src="https://tse1.mm.bing.net/th?q=إثبات المعرفة الصفرية في بلوكتشين" alt="إثبات المعرفة الصفرية في بلوكتشين"></center>
<h2>ما هو إثبات المعرفة الصفرية؟</h2>
<ul>
<li> تعريف شامل لإثبات المعرفة الصفرية.</li>
<li> شرح مبسط لآلية عملها.</li>
</ul>
<h3>مفهوم إثبات المعرفة الصفرية</h3>
<p>إثبات المعرفة الصفرية (Zero-Knowledge Proof - ZKP) هو بروتوكول تشفير يسمح لطرف (المُثبِت) بإثبات لطرف آخر (المُتحقِّق) أنه يعرف معلومة معينة، دون الكشف عن أي معلومات حول تلك المعلومة نفسها. بمعنى آخر، يمكن للمُثبِت إقناع المُتحقِّق بأنه يعرف سرًا معينًا دون الكشف عن السر نفسه. هذا المفهوم يعتبر ثورة في عالم الأمن الرقمي.</p>
<p>لفهم هذا المفهوم بشكل أفضل، تخيل أن لديك لغزًا معقدًا تعرف حله. باستخدام إثبات المعرفة الصفرية، يمكنك إثبات لشخص آخر أنك تعرف الحل دون الكشف عن الحل نفسه. هذا يضمن خصوصية المعلومات ويمنع تسربها إلى جهات غير مصرح لها.</p>
<p>هناك أنواع مختلفة من إثبات المعرفة الصفرية، ولكل منها خصائصها ومميزاتها. بعض الأنواع أكثر كفاءة من غيرها، بينما يوفر البعض الآخر مستوى أعلى من الأمان. يعتمد اختيار النوع المناسب على التطبيق المحدد ومتطلباته.</p>
<h3>كيف يعمل إثبات المعرفة الصفرية؟</h3>
<p>تعتمد آلية عمل إثبات المعرفة الصفرية على عمليات حسابية معقدة تضمن صحة الإثبات دون الكشف عن المعلومات الأساسية. تتضمن هذه العمليات عادةً استخدام دوال تجزئة تشفيرية وتقنيات أخرى متقدمة. الهدف هو إنشاء دليل رياضي يثبت صحة الادعاء دون الكشف عن أي تفاصيل إضافية.</p>
<p>على سبيل المثال، في أحد أنواع إثبات المعرفة الصفرية، يُطلب من المُثبِت حل معادلة رياضية معقدة يعرف نتيجتها. يمكن للمُتحقِّق التحقق من صحة الحل دون معرفة المعادلة نفسها أو طريقة حلها. هذا يضمن سرية المعلومات ويمنع تسريبها.</p>
<p>تتطور تقنيات إثبات المعرفة الصفرية باستمرار، وتسعى الأبحاث الحالية إلى تحسين كفاءتها وجعلها أكثر سهولة في الاستخدام. هذا سيفتح الباب أمام استخدامها في تطبيقات جديدة ومبتكرة في المستقبل.</p>
<h3>أمثلة على إثبات المعرفة الصفرية</h3>
<p>لتوضيح مفهوم إثبات المعرفة الصفرية بشكل أكبر، دعونا نلقي نظرة على بعض الأمثلة العملية. تخيل أنك تريد تسجيل الدخول إلى حسابك المصرفي عبر الإنترنت. باستخدام إثبات المعرفة الصفرية، يمكنك إثبات هويتك دون الكشف عن كلمة مرورك. هذا يحمي حسابك من الاختراق ويضمن سرية بياناتك.</p>
<p>مثال آخر هو استخدام إثبات المعرفة الصفرية في التصويت الإلكتروني. يمكن للناخبين إثبات حقهم في التصويت دون الكشف عن هويتهم أو خياراتهم الانتخابية. هذا يضمن سرية وسلامة العملية الانتخابية.</p>
<p>في مجال البلوكتشين، يمكن استخدام إثبات المعرفة الصفرية لتنفيذ معاملات خاصة دون الكشف عن تفاصيلها. هذا يحمي خصوصية المستخدمين ويمنع تتبع معاملاتهم.</p>
<center><img src="https://tse1.mm.bing.net/th?q=تطبيقات إثبات المعرفة الصفرية في البلوكتشين" alt="تطبيقات إثبات المعرفة الصفرية في البلوكتشين"></center>
<h2>تطبيقات إثبات المعرفة الصفرية في البلوكتشين</h2>
<ul>
<li> المعاملات الخاصة</li>
<li> الهوية الرقمية</li>
<li> التوسيع</li>
</ul>
<h3>المعاملات الخاصة</h3>
<p>تُستخدم تقنية إثبات المعرفة الصفرية في البلوكتشين لتمكين المعاملات الخاصة. حيث يمكن للأطراف إجراء معاملات دون الكشف عن قيمة المعاملة أو هوية المشاركين.</p>
<p>هذا يحافظ على خصوصية المستخدمين ويمنع تتبع معاملاتهم. وهو أمر مهم بشكل خاص في العملات الرقمية التي تركز على الخصوصية.</p>
<p>تعد Zcash و Monero أمثلة على العملات الرقمية التي تستخدم إثبات المعرفة الصفرية لتحقيق الخصوصية.</p>
<h3>الهوية الرقمية</h3>
<p>يمكن استخدام إثبات المعرفة الصفرية للتحقق من الهوية الرقمية دون الكشف عن معلومات شخصية حساسة. يمكن للمستخدمين إثبات هويتهم دون الكشف عن أسمائهم أو عناوينهم أو تواريخ ميلادهم.</p>
<p>هذا يحمي خصوصية المستخدمين ويمنع سرقة الهوية. ويساعد في بناء نظام هوية رقمي آمن وموثوق.</p>
<p>يمكن استخدام هذه التقنية في تطبيقات مثل التصويت الإلكتروني والخدمات الحكومية عبر الإنترنت.</p>
<h3>التوسيع</h3>
<p>تساعد تقنية إثبات المعرفة الصفرية في توسيع شبكات البلوكتشين. حيث يمكنها تقليل حجم البيانات التي يجب معالجتها وتخزينها على الشبكة.</p>
<p>هذا يحسن كفاءة الشبكة ويقلل من التكاليف. ويساعد في حل مشكلة قابلية التوسع التي تواجه العديد من شبكات البلوكتشين.</p>
<p>تستخدم بعض البلوكتشين مثل Polygon تقنية إثبات المعرفة الصفرية لتحسين قابلية التوسع.</p>
<center><img src="https://tse1.mm.bing.net/th?q=فوائد إثبات المعرفة الصفرية" alt="فوائد إثبات المعرفة الصفرية"></center>
<h2>فوائد إثبات المعرفة الصفرية</h2>
<ul>
<li>الخصوصية والأمان</li>
<li>الكفاءة والتوسع</li>
<li>الثقة والشفافية</li>
</ul>
<h3>الخصوصية والأمان</h3>
<p>تكمن الفائدة الرئيسية لإثبات المعرفة الصفرية في تعزيز الخصوصية والأمان. حيث تسمح هذه التقنية بالتحقق من المعلومات دون الكشف عن البيانات الحساسة.</p>
<p>هذا يحمي المستخدمين من سرقة البيانات وانتهاك الخصوصية. ويعزز الثقة في التفاعلات الرقمية.</p>
<p>تعتبر الخصوصية والأمان من أهم العوامل في نجاح تطبيقات البلوكتشين.</p>
<h3>الكفاءة والتوسع</h3>
<p>تساهم تقنية إثبات المعرفة الصفرية في تحسين كفاءة وتوسيع شبكات البلوكتشين. حيث تقلل من حجم البيانات التي يجب معالجتها وتخزينها.</p>
<p>هذا يسرع من عمليات التحقق ويقلل من التكاليف. ويساعد في التغلب على قيود قابلية التوسع التي تواجهها العديد من البلوكتشين.</p>
<p>تعد الكفاءة والتوسع من التحديات الرئيسية التي تواجه تكنولوجيا البلوكتشين.</p>
<h3>الثقة والشفافية</h3>
<p>على الرغم من أن إثبات المعرفة الصفرية يخفي البيانات الحساسة، إلا أنه يعزز الثقة والشفافية. حيث يسمح بالتحقق من صحة المعلومات دون الكشف عن تفاصيلها.</p>
<p>هذا يبني الثقة بين الأطراف المتفاعلة. ويدعم إنشاء أنظمة موثوقة وشفافة.</p>
<p>تعد الثقة والشفافية من أهم عناصر نجاح أي نظام قائم على البلوكتشين.</p>
<center><img src="https://tse1.mm.bing.net/th?q=تحديات إثبات المعرفة الصفرية" alt="تحديات إثبات المعرفة الصفرية"></center>
<h2>تحديات إثبات المعرفة الصفرية</h2>
<ul>
<li>التعقيد التقني</li>
<li>قابلية التوسع</li>
<li>الثقة في التطبيقات</li>
</ul>
<h3>التعقيد التقني</h3>
<p>تعتبر تقنية إثبات المعرفة الصفرية معقدة من الناحية التقنية. ويتطلب تنفيذها خبرات متخصصة في التشفير والرياضيات.</p>
<p>هذا يجعل من الصعب على المطورين دمجها في تطبيقاتهم. ويحد من انتشارها على نطاق واسع.</p>
<p>يتطلب التغلب على هذا التحدي تبسيط التقنية وتوفير أدوات سهلة الاستخدام للمطورين.</p>
<h3>قابلية التوسع</h3>
<p>على الرغم من مساهمتها في تحسين قابلية التوسع في بعض الحالات، إلا أن تقنية إثبات المعرفة الصفرية لا تزال تواجه تحديات في هذا الجانب. حيث يمكن أن تكون عمليات التحقق مكلفة من حيث الموارد الحسابية.</p>
<p>هذا يحد من قدرتها على معالجة عدد كبير من المعاملات. ويؤثر على أدائها في الشبكات المزدحمة.</p>
<p>يتطلب تحسين قابلية التوسع تطوير خوارزميات أكثر كفاءة وتقنيات تحسين الأداء.</p>
<h3>الثقة في التطبيقات</h3>
<p>يعد بناء الثقة في تطبيقات إثبات المعرفة الصفرية من التحديات المهمة. حيث يصعب على المستخدمين فهم آلية عمل التقنية والتأكد من سلامتها.</p>
<p>هذا قد يؤدي إلى التردد في استخدام التطبيقات التي تعتمد عليها. ويعيق انتشارها على نطاق واسع.</p>
<p>يتطلب بناء الثقة توعية المستخدمين بفوائد التقنية وشرح آلية عملها بشكل مبسط.</p>
<h2>جدول مقارنة لأنواع إثبات المعرفة الصفرية </h2>
<table border="1">
<tr>
<th>النوع</th>
<th>الوصف</th>
<th>المميزات</th>
<th>العيوب</th>
</tr>
<tr>
<td>ZK-SNARKs</td>
<td>دليل غير تفاعلي موجز</td>
<td>حجم دليل صغير، سرعة تحقق عالية</td>
<td>يتطلب إعداد موثوق</td>
</tr>
<tr>
<td>ZK-STARKs</td>
<td>دليل غير تفاعلي شفاف</td>
<td>لا يتطلب إعداد موثوق، مقاومة لحساب الكم</td>
<td>حجم دليل أكبر من ZK-SNARKs</td>
</tr>
<tr>
<td>Bulletproofs</td>
<td>دليل قصير وغير تفاعلي</td>
<td>حجم دليل صغير، لا يتطلب إعداد موثوق</td>
<td>أبطأ في التحقق من ZK-SNARKs</td>
</tr>
</table>
<h2>مستقبل إثبات المعرفة الصفرية في البلوكتشين</h2>
<p>يتوقع أن يلعب إثبات المعرفة الصفرية دورًا محوريًا في مستقبل البلوكتشين. حيث يمكن أن يساهم في تحسين الخصوصية والأمان والكفاءة.</p>
<p>من المتوقع أن تزداد تطبيقات إثبات المعرفة الصفرية في مجالات مثل الهوية الرقمية والمعاملات الخاصة والتصويت الإلكتروني.</p>
<p>ستشهد التقنية مزيدًا من التطوير والتحسين لتصبح أكثر سهولة في الاستخدام وأقل تكلفة.</p>
<h2>الأسئلة الشائعة حول إثبات المعرفة الصفرية</h2>
<p>س1: ما هو الفرق بين ZK-SNARKs و ZK-STARKs؟</p>
<p>ج1: يعتبر ZK-STARKs أكثر شفافية ولا يتطلب إعدادًا موثوقًا مثل ZK-SNARKs، ولكنه ينتج أدلة أكبر حجمًا. أما ZK-SNARKs فهو أسرع في التحقق ولكنه يتطلب إعدادًا موثوقًا قد يشكل خطرًا أمنيًا.</p>
<p>س2: كيف يمكن استخدام إثبات المعرفة الصفرية في التصويت الإلكتروني؟</p>
<p>ج2: يمكن استخدامه للسماح للناخبين بالتحقق من أصواتهم دون الكشف عن هويتهم أو اختياراتهم الانتخابية، مما يضمن سرية ونتيجة انتخابات شفافة.</p>
<p>س3: هل إثبات المعرفة الصفرية آمن تمامًا؟</p>
<p>ج3: تعتبر تقنية إثبات المعرفة الصفرية آمنة بشكل عام، ولكنها تعتمد على افتراضات رياضية معقدة. قد تظهر ثغرات أمنية في المستقبل، ولكن الخبراء يعملون باستمرار على تحسين أمان التقنية.</p>
<h2>الخلاصة</h2>
<p>في الختام، تعتبر تقنية إثبات المعرفة الصفرية في بلوكتشين نقلة نوعية في عالم الأمن الرقمي والخصوصية. تتيح هذه التقنية الرائدة إمكانية التحقق من المعلومات دون الكشف عن البيانات الحساسة، مما يفتح آفاقًا واسعة لتطبيقات مبتكرة في مختلف المجالات.</p>
<p>بينما لا تزال هناك بعض التحديات التي تواجه هذه التقنية، إلا أن فوائدها الكبيرة تجعلها محط اهتمام كبير من قبل المطورين والباحثين. نتطلع إلى رؤية المزيد من التطورات في هذا المجال في السنوات القادمة. لا تنسى التحقق من المقالات الأخرى على موقعنا لمعرفة المزيد عن أحدث التقنيات في عالم البلوكتشين.</p>
<p>إثبات المعرفة الصفرية هو حقًا أداة قوية في عالم البلوكتشين. تابعنا للمزيد من المعلومات حول إثبات المعرفة الصفرية في بلوكتشين.</p>
في ختام رحلتنا لاستكشاف إثبات المعرفة الصفرية في عالم البلوكتشين، نجد أنفسنا أمام تقنيةٍ ثوريةٍ تحمل في طياتها إمكانياتٍ هائلةً لتغيير مفهوم الخصوصية والأمان. فمن خلال فصل المعلومة عن إثبات صحتها، تُمكّننا هذه التقنية من التفاعل بشكلٍ آمنٍ ودون الكشف عن بياناتنا الحساسة. علاوةً على ذلك، فإنّ استخدام إثبات المعرفة الصفرية يُعزز من كفاءة العمليات على البلوكتشين، حيث يُقلل من حجم البيانات التي يجب معالجتها وتخزينها. وبالتالي، فإنّ هذه التقنية لا تُعزز الخصوصية فحسب، بل تُساهم أيضاً في تحسين أداء الشبكات وتقليل التكاليف. أخيراً، مع استمرار تطور هذه التكنولوجيا وتوسع تطبيقاتها، نحن على أعتاب عصرٍ جديدٍ من الابتكار والأمان في عالم البلوكتشين.
ولكن، على الرغم من المزايا الواضحة لإثبات المعرفة الصفرية، إلا أنَّ هناك بعض التحديات التي تواجه تطبيقها على نطاق واسع. فعلى سبيل المثال، تتطلب بعض بروتوكولات إثبات المعرفة الصفرية قدراً كبيراً من الموارد الحاسوبية، مما قد يُؤثر على سرعة وتكلفة العمليات. بالإضافة إلى ذلك، فإن تطوير وتنفيذ هذه البروتوكولات يتطلب خبراتٍ تقنيةً متقدمة، مما قد يُحدّ من انتشارها في المراحل الأولية. ومع ذلك، فمع تزايد الاهتمام بهذه التقنية وتسارع وتيرة البحث والتطوير، من المتوقع أن تتغلب هذه التحديات بمرور الوقت. وعلاوةً على ما سبق، فإنَّ التكامل بين إثبات المعرفة الصفرية وتقنيات البلوكتشين الأخرى، مثل العقود الذكية، يُبشّر بظهور تطبيقاتٍ جديدةٍ ومبتكرةٍ في مختلف المجالات. ومن ثمَّ، فإن مستقبل إثبات المعرفة الصفرية يبدو واعداً جداً، وسيكون له تأثيرٌ كبيرٌ على شكل المعاملات الرقمية في المستقبل.
في النهاية، ندعوكم إلى مواصلة استكشاف عالم إثبات المعرفة الصفرية وتطبيقاتها المتنوعة. فمن خلال الفهم العُمق لهذه التقنية، يمكننا الاستفادة من إمكانياتها الهائلة لبناء مستقبلٍ رقميٍّ أكثر أماناً وخصوصية. ولا شك أنَّ التعاون والتبادل المعرفي يلعبان دوراً أساسياً في دفع عجلة الابتكار في هذا المجال. لذا، نُشجعكم على المشاركة في النقاشات وورش العمل المتعلقة بهذه التقنية ومتابعة أحدث التطورات والأبحاث في هذا الشأن. وبهذا، نكون قد ألقينا نظرةً شاملةً على إثبات المعرفة الصفرية في بلوكتشين، متطلعين إلى مستقبلٍ واعدٍ حيث تُصبح الخصوصية والأمان جزءاً لا يتجزأ من تجربتنا الرقمية. فمع تطور هذه التقنية، ستُفتح أبوابٌ جديدةٌ للابتكار في مختلف المجالات، من الخدمات المالية إلى الرعاية الصحية وغيرها الكثير. لذا، فإن الاستثمار في فهم وتطوير هذه التقنية يُعد أمراً ضرورياً للاستفادة من إمكانياتها الكاملة وبناء مستقبلٍ رقميٍّ أكثر أمناً واستدامة.

